Hello XeqtR, please introduce yourself.
Hi, my name is Jørgen, handle in CS "XeqtR", 20 years old and I'm currently playing for Adrenaline.
For how long have you played CS? And in what clans? Share your history!
Ohh, that'll take some time...ok here goes - I started
playing CS in Beta 3.1. Clans I've played in(chronologically) N.A.T.O(no),
HIFI(swe), MAD(dk), SoA(dk), c9/team9/NiP(swe), All*(dk/swe), GoL(swe),
Nordic(standin, swe), eoL/esu*eoL/GoL.eoL(no) and now currently playing for
Adrenaline former team9.
I first got introduced to the game @ a LAN with some of my friends and where I by accident got a CD-key that worked online, and so when I was bored one day and I wanted to play something else then BW that I played alot before I started with cs, that was the only game I could actually play online and I guess from that moment on I was stuck with this stupid mofo game;). Anyways, I knew a guy from BW that was actually trying out for the best norwegian clan in norway at that time and so I got to try a bit for them aswell even thou I wasnt really that good and hadn't played it more then a couple of weeks, anyways I got rly known on public servers and so with my clan tag + I started to kill alot of ppl..HE HE.
We were pretty unbeatable in Norway, but then we played TF(team fortuna) and we lost big time so I saw that if i wanted to play on a higher level i had to switch from norway to sweden, and so I joined HIFI, and I played with them for about 6-7 months and we got to do very well at CB etc. and then when summer hit again ppl got inactive and I had to find a new clan, so then I got this offer from MAD-Kato, some Danish guy who owned a netcafe in denmark and he had a up and coming clan going on in denmark.
So I joined up with them, and we did pretty well and beat many of the top clans in dk such as SoA, but then we lost to TNB in a cupmatch and that was basically cuz we didnt practice as much as I wanted so I eventually left that clan and I joined up with SoA, because I was rly active at that time in the dk scene, and around that time the first CPL europe was on the works and so was going so that became my next goal.
After we placed 2nd with SoA, some things didnt feel right, first of all the whole team except me were located in the same town in dk so they could LAN alot and etc etc, and so I basically left them, and joined up with the Swedish team called c9 at that time, where Potti,hyb, kuros, cogline, medion playd at that time, I had gotten to know potti and hyb aswell at the CPL event so they pretty much knew what i stood for and so i could join the team even thou i was norwegian and all. ;)
c9/team9 was a great time, we pretty much owned anything and everything, and were getting ready for CPL US, but then after some problems with some members in the team we didnt go afterall and that made the team break apart, and ppl went left and right, Potti, heaton and myself ended up in Allstars, shortly thereafter heaton joined SoA.swe aswell where medion
and hyb had went after the breakup.
Potti and i went to cpl holland with 3 Danish guyz, majestic, jackieboy and vicon and where we placed 2nd after losing to soa.swe in final. But already then we kinda knew that the old team9 lineup did alot of the things happen for the both teams in that tournament so we kinda just got together after that event and we formed NiP again that was the old name of team9 before they got sponsored by 9.
With NiP, I won CPL London and CPL berlin and some minor Swedish event, and then after CPL Berlin after some internal problems i got kicked from NiP and I joined up with GoL with GoL I came 3rd at the CPL Winter championship in Dallas where NiP won, after that event i was pretty dissapointed in some how the teammembers had performed compared to how they had performed before the event so i basically left that team right after the event and a month later i joined up with NiP again
Then winter came again and we just pracced and pracced with NiP and then when the events were coming up we suddenly couldnt go to any of them because we didnt have any sponsors in NiP even tho we were told by ppl that were supposed to handle that part had told us all the time that we had
it...and so in order for us to be able to play in the summer events. between SK and NiP i played in a cpl europe with Nordic as a standin because NiP couldnt go because scream was too young, I won that event with nordic.
Potti heaton and i joined up with SK and Xenon. We took in Dark and so we played the summer events, LA7 didnt go that well but that was mainly cuz of shitty organisment etc...shortly after we won CPL summer, and then as usual after the event there were some problems, mainly inactivity from myself and dark that made the others look for some new players, something dark and i didnt agree on, so dark and i left sk and joined up with eol.
With eol i won the mindtrek cpl qualifier that was pretty much a mini cpl, but then we failed badly at the cpl winter even tho we were big favourites by many, we didnt prepare well enough for the event because we got too confident after the mindtrek lan, so we placed like 8th there and then we kept going on with eol, and won cb eurocup finals, then some new sponsors and name changes but basically the same team except damien out and element in.
We came 2nd at clik and 1st at eswc qualifier @ nine, then after owning up sk alot, element decided to join them. ;) So we were left with 4 players only weeks before eswc and so i felt it wasn't enough time to build up a new team so i joined up with team9 before the summer events.
With team9 i won eswc and came 2nd at cpl summer and then
i havent been so much active since that so that pretty much caps it up, team9 changed name to adrenaline and my team is currently living in america and im under a 1 year contract with the team with salary and that pretty much sums up my CS Career.
If you were able to freeze time and play with one clan for eternity, which one would you pick?
Either OLD nip that played in CPL London, or GoL.eoL lineup @ the eswc qualifier and clikarena. Just because then i felt that the team I were playing in at that time were pretty much complete and i felt very confident going into an event. I won't say adrenaline right now because of all the roster changes and instable results...but maybe after the winter events it'll be adrenaline. ;)
You're born in Norway, you've played wish danes, swedes and americans. Has your language ever stopped you from performing well?
No, my communication has always been somewhat my strong point ingame espacially, and pregame tactics...either in norwegian, Swedish or english...with soa i could also understand some Danish, but i talked english then..but never a problem.
Where in USA does your team live? Do they have their own house together of dirrerent apartments?
Well, the team is currently living in California, in an appartment with their own car etc. And they are playing from the Gamers-X LAN-center.
Do you think that living together can cause any trouble?
That i dont know that much about since I'm not currently staying with the team in america, but I dont think so since everybody is good friends except the fact that they are playing in the same team, orelse we couldnt do such a drastic move as this.
You are playing with both the Swedish and the american team. How is it possible?
yes, basically it is for me to stay in shape before the winter events, and because SEL doesnt allow more then 3 new players so we couldnt form a new team without atleast 2 from the adrenaline that played in the previous SEL season. I'll go to USA in december to practise for cXg.
Who pays your trips around the world?
Gamers-X does. Or their sponsors, Sehnheiser.
Every organisation are only able to send one team to CPL-events. Is it the best performing team that'll go?
We are under one organisation i dont think the "other" team is under the same organisation so both teams will attend cpl winter. By that i mean, Adrenaline-gx have our own organisation that doesnt include any other team.

Do your parents support your gaming?
They dont like that it has taken such a big part of my life, but thats about it, trying to make me stop a couple of times. but nothing serious. ;)
But don't they support you when they see all the money you've won?
Well, the point is that i havent gotten half of what ive actually won, some because CPL hasnt had the prize money, or i just havent gotten my share of the money from the team i played under;( etc etc...but right now im doing rly well so now they arent complaining as much as before. Must remember ive played since the very first cpl europe and then the prize money wasnt that big and no salaries etc...so back then i didnt make so much money compared to the time i invested in it, but thats about to change now..
If i haven't miscounted, you'll be six men in USA at winter. Who isn't going to play?
Dont know yet, that we will have to figure out when i get there...most likely we'll go with a 6 man rotation in CPL Dallas and then switch to a 5 man lineup with one sub, based on how we played @ CPL
